The word thug probably came from a phonetic distortion of the Hindi and Urdu word thag, meaning thief or swindler. Thug Life is a popular phrase in today’s Hip Hop culture, though very few know what it actually means and why it’s used. 1810, "member of a gang of murderers and robbers in India who strangled their victims," from Marathi thag, thak "cheat, swindler," Hindi thag, perhaps from Sanskrit sthaga-s "cunning, fraudulent," from sthagayati "(he) covers, conceals," from PIE root *(s)teg- "to cover.". The first known record of the Thugs as an organized group, as opposed to ordinary thieves, is in Ẓiyāʾ-ud-Dīn Baranī's History of Fīrūz Shāh dated to around 1356.
